Obs. [Prob. a variant of *bill (not actually found in this sense, but cf. BILLET) a. F. bille ‘a young stocke of a tree to graft on’ (Cotgr.); cf. 12th c. med.L. billa, billus ‘branch, trunk of a tree.’] ? The crossbar of the yoke.

1

1616.  Surfl. & Markh., Countr. Farm, 650. The young plants are good to make beeles for Yoakes.
